Summary

The First Minister answers questions from Party Leaders and other MSPs in this weekly question time.Topics covered this week include: Paul McLennan To ask the First Minister whether he will provide an update on the Scottish Government's latest engagement with the UK Government regarding any impact on poverty levels in Scotland of the freeze to Local Housing Allowance.Murdo Fraser To ask the First Minister what funding is in place to ensure that the A9 dualling project is completed by the target date of 2035.Stuart McMillan To ask the First Minister whether he will provide an update on whether the Scottish Government will instigate a direct award to Ferguson Marine for the replacement of MV Lord of the Isles.
